Abstract
Euplotes focardii, a ciliate species recently collected from sand sediments of Terra Nova Bay (Ross Sea, Antarctica) reproduced in the laboratory with a duplication time of approximately 72 h, at 4°C. Strains representative of two different mating types were identified and mixed together to produce mating pairs. These showed traits rather unusual for Euplotes species. The two pair members remained united for at least 8–10 days. However, only one carried out fertilization and was able to give rise to a new clone of vegetative cells; the other underwent cell body shrinking after 4–5 days of union, lost the locomotory ciliary apparatus, and eventually died. By analyses of mating pairs formed in mixtures of cell samples cytologically distinct from each other, it was ascertained that the different cell behavior is strain-specific.
